2. Essential Materials and Stitches for a Modern Granny Square
To begin your modern crochet granny square pattern, you’ll need just a few basic tools: a crochet hook, yarn, scissors, and a tapestry needle for weaving in the ends. Choosing the right hook size is crucial—it affects the texture and size of your squares. Most modern patterns use hooks between 4 mm and 5.5 mm, depending on the yarn weight.
Yarn choice is another key element. Opt for smooth, high-quality yarns that enhance stitch definition. Cotton yarns provide a clean, modern look, while wool blends add warmth and softness. If you want a lightweight summer project, consider bamboo or linen yarns. The modern crochet granny square pattern looks stunning in natural tones or soft pastel shades.
Now let’s talk about stitches. The most common ones used are chain stitch, slip stitch, and double crochet stitch. Once you master these three, you’ll be able to create almost any granny square variation. Practice tension control to ensure each square has consistent size and structure.
Another modern twist involves experimenting with textured stitches. Try popcorn stitches, puff stitches, or bobbles for extra dimension. Adding texture can elevate a simple granny square pattern into a statement piece that draws attention.
Don’t forget to block your squares after finishing them. Blocking helps shape your work and gives a professional finish. Simply dampen the squares and pin them flat to dry—it’s an essential step for a polished result.
Lastly, organizing your colors before starting can save time and improve harmony in your design. Many crocheters plan their layout using a grid or mood board to visualize how each modern granny square will fit into the final piece.
3. Creative Variations and Design Ideas
The beauty of the modern crochet granny square pattern lies in its endless versatility. You can customize it to match your taste, from minimalistic neutral tones to bold geometric patterns. Let’s explore some of the most creative ways to give your granny squares a fresh, modern look.
First, consider using monochromatic schemes. Instead of mixing many colors, try different shades of one hue. This technique creates a sophisticated gradient effect perfect for home décor, such as throws or cushion covers.
Next, play with negative space. Many modern crocheters leave some open spaces or combine solid and openwork designs to give their squares a lighter, airier feel. This makes them ideal for summer garments or decorative wall hangings.
For fashion-forward projects, try asymmetric arrangements. Instead of the classic square-on-square layout, combine rectangles, triangles, or half-squares for a dynamic composition. This unconventional approach makes your modern granny square pattern stand out from traditional designs.
Another popular idea is mixing fibers. Combine cotton with metallic or velvet yarns to add contrast and luxury. These combinations work beautifully in accessories like handbags, scarves, and shawls.
You can also incorporate modern motifs into your granny squares. Floral patterns, abstract designs, or even minimalist symbols can add personality and meaning to your work. Each square can tell a story, turning your crochet into wearable art.
Finally, experiment with joining techniques. Instead of the usual whip stitch, try join-as-you-go methods or invisible seams. These methods not only look neater but also save time, keeping your modern crochet granny square project smooth and cohesive.
4. How to Assemble and Finish Your Granny Square Projects
Once you have your collection of beautiful squares, the next step is assembling them. Proper joining can make or break your modern crochet granny square pattern project, so take your time with this stage.
Start by arranging your squares on a flat surface to visualize the final layout. This helps you balance colors and patterns before stitching. Rearrange them until you find the perfect combination that pleases your eye.
When joining, use a method that complements your design. The slip stitch join creates a flat, seamless look, while the single crochet join adds texture and definition between squares. The modern granny square pattern often benefits from a clean, minimal seam to highlight the design rather than the connection.
After joining, weave in all loose ends carefully. This step may feel tedious, but it ensures your piece looks neat and professional. Secure each thread firmly so your project remains durable and washable.
Adding a border can completely transform the look of your work. For modern styles, simple borders in neutral colors—like gray, white, or beige—create a sleek, contemporary finish. If you prefer contrast, a bold black border can make the colors pop.
Finally, block your finished piece one more time. This helps even out any uneven tension and gives your crochet project a crisp, polished appearance. Your modern crochet granny square pattern will now be ready to display or gift with pride.
